Has there been any attempt and creating a formalized method for organizing CSS code?

  • 0

Has there been any attempt and creating a formalized method for organizing CSS code? Before I go and make up my own strategy for keeping things readable, I’m wondering what else is out there. Google hasn’t been very helpful, as I’m not entirely sure what terms to search for.

I’m thinking more along the lines of indenting/spacing, when to use new lines, naming conventions, etc.

Any ideas?

    Natalie Down of ClearLeft fame produced a really great slide show covering this topic and more http://natbat.net/2008/Sep/28/css-systems/

    Download the PDF as it includes a lot more information than the slide show. I’d recommend this to CSS devs of all skill levels.
